About Homes Under $500K inLiberty, MO
Liberty, MO has 64 homes under $500k for sale right now, with a median list price of $399,900 as of Sep 17 These homes under $500k were built between 1880 and 2026, ranging from 888 to 3,946 square feet.
Homes Under $500K market trendsLiberty, MO
Liberty, MO: 84 homes for sale · 7 new in the last 7 days · median asking $417,475 · 32 price reductions · a median of 18 days to contract. 26 homes closed in the last 30 days, at a median of $385,000. At the pace of the last 90 days that is 1.83 months of supply.
| Measure | Aug 2026 |
|---|---|
| Median sale price | $375,000 |
| Median price per sq ft | $182 |
| Median days to contract | 14 |
| Sell-to-list ratio | 100% |
| Homes sold | 39 |
| New listings | 45 |
| Went under contract | 31 |

How we compute these
- Market.
- Market type is set by months of supply — how long it would take to sell every home for sale at the current pace. Under ~4 months favors sellers (low inventory, faster sales, homes near or above asking); over ~6 favors buyers (more choice, more negotiating room). 4–6 is balanced.
- Months supply.
- How many months it would take to sell every home now for sale at the pace of the last 90 days: homes for sale ÷ (closings in the last 90 days ÷ 3).
- For sale.
- Homes listed as active right now. A live count, not a monthly average.
- Days to contract.
- The middle number of days between a home being listed and going under contract, over the last 90 days of closings. It is not days-to-close, and it is not how long today's listings have been sitting. Newly built homes are excluded, because a build finishing is not a market moving.
- Coming soon.
- Homes announced but not yet accepting showings. A live count.
- Under contract.
- Homes with an accepted contract that have not closed yet. A live count.
